- Best way to travel from London to Blenheim Palace for day
Travel by GWR from London Paddington, Reading, or Worcester to Hanborough (then connect to Blenheim by Bus 233) There are rail connections available from many other cities, by changing at Reading, Didcot Parkway or Birmingham New Street For train times and journey planner visit our Good Journey Page, nationalrail co uk or call 08457 484950

- Oxford and Blenheim Palace in 48 hours? - Rick Steves
From the Blenheim website: "Stagecoach Bus S3 runs from Oxford City Centre to Woodstock, four times an hour, 7 days a week Buses stop outside the main entrance, from there it's a 10 minute stroll through the park to Blenheim Palace " "We offer 20% off Palace, Park Garden tickets for visitors arriving by bus – on our website use the code GREEN20 at checkout " * https: www blenheimpalace

- Blenheim palace from London - Rick Steves Travel Forum
Not walkable (9 miles) - take Bus S3 from Oxford Station to the Palace Gates (Woodstock)- 1 hour train journey then 40 minute bus ride Normally you would get a 20% discount for travelling green but not at Christmas as there are special ticketing arrangements in force via Raymond Gubbay (an Agency)
- Windsor Castle, Hampton Court Palace, or Blenheim Palace
Blenheim is the hardest to get to and since it is someone's home you're limited to the rooms you can visit It is lovely and if it bores you, Oxford is near Love Windsor Castle but when you're done seeing the bits tourists are allowed in you're left with the town and the long walk Mind you its a really cute town Hampton Court Palace my choice
